The readings provide students exposure to the unique perspectives of various historians and the challenges of an evolving country.  The anthology explores the place of food in historic events, a history of the Puritans, Native Americans and historical consciousness in the 19th century, industrial capitalism, changes in the labor force in recent times, and more. Each reading is framed by an introduction, which places it in context and prepares students for effective reading, and post-reading questions that encourage students to explore and analyze ideas and information.  The second edition features new readings on American Reconstruction and the 19th century roots of the Stone-Campbell Movement.  Problems in U.S. History helps students understand that history is more than a sequence of events, composed of the challenges people experience, the values they hold, and the changes in culture that occur with the evolution of a specific place. It is an ideal textbook for foundational courses in U.S. history.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"US \/ VERY_G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":50117369397521,"sku":"CIN1516538455VG","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 NEW \/ INGRAM","offer_id":52590033371409,"sku":"NLS9781516538454","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"US \/ NEW \/ INGRAM","offer_id":52751204221201,"sku":"NIN9781516538454","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/1516538455.jpg?v=1764844690"},{"product_id":"wwqt-journal-worldwide-quiet-time-journal-book-jim-cook-9781888796445","title":"WWQT Journal -- Worldwide Quiet Time Journal","description":null,"br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"US \/ G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":50401654964497,"sku":"CIN1888796448G","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/1888796448.jpg?v=1750725955"},{"product_id":"arizona-liar-s-journal-book-jim-cook-9781931725033","title":"Arizona Liar's Journal","description":null,"br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"US \/ G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":50401759068433,"sku":"CIN1931725039G","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/1931725039.jpg?v=1750900575"},{"product_id":"problems-in-u-s-history-book-jim-cook-9781516572861","title":"Problems in U.S. History","description":"In presenting students with diverse issues and interests, the selections in \u003ci\u003eProblems in U.S. History\u003c\/i\u003e help readers think critically about the social, political, and cultural issues that have shaped America. In 2005, Jim and his brother Dean, a songwriter and storyteller, were named Arizona Culturekeepers for their work in keeping alive the lore of Arizona. After a long career in journalism, Jim became the Official State Liar of Arizona. He is director of the Wickenburg Institute for Factual Diversity, which is a think tank for recreational liars, and a treatment center for recovering newspapermen. He also edits the institute's organ, The Journal of Prevarication. Long-term readers of Jim's tall tales often complain that they can't tell where truth ends and lies begin. Half a Sack of Cats is factual. It tells of Jim's unlikely childhood in Arizona, as Arizona used to be.
